public async Task <IActionResult> Delete(string id) { var result = await _socialNetworkService.Delete(id); if (result.Code <= 0) { return(BadRequest(result)); } return(Ok(result)); }
public ActionResult SocialNetworkDelete(int id, GridCommand command) { var socialNetwork = socialNetworkService.GetById(id); if (socialNetwork != null) { var entityId = socialNetwork.EntityId; socialNetworkService.Delete(socialNetwork); return(SocialNetworkList(command, entityId)); } return(SocialNetworkList(command, "-1")); }
public async Task <IActionResult> DeleteSocialNetwork(short id) { var socialNetwork = await _socialNetworkService.GetAll().AsNoTracking().FirstOrDefaultAsync(s => s.Id == id); var result = false; try { await _socialNetworkService.Delete(socialNetwork); result = true; } catch { } return(new JsonResult(new { result = result })); }